Output 21afa8e677d6eb0b3495d7e201b7bd50a4524d640437ad972a13ab28eac42f91:1

value
59042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94b8afbe9202ffe84183c9fec556a0bb3bc15358 OP_EQUAL
address
3FFPBBGDQJ1rUF8dx3d3ARiZzeeZBeN2eg
transaction
21afa8e677d6eb0b3495d7e201b7bd50a4524d640437ad972a13ab28eac42f91
spent
true